About Marianne Simonsen
Simonsen is professor at the Department of Economics and Business Economics, Aarhus University. She is a research fellow at CESifo and RFBerlin and affiliated with TrygFonden's Centre for Child Research. Since 2023, she has been editor at Scandinavian Journal of Economics.
Simonsen's academic interests lie within family, health and labor economics. She currently explores how reforms of welfare policies affect children's wellbeing and human capital; the role of universal parenting support during the transition to parenthood; and how to support children who grow up in families plagued by substance use problems.
